If Kazuchika Okada is New Japan Pro Wrestling's ace and Kenny Omega the company's leading gaijin, Tetsuya Naito is their biggest homegrown star.

The charismatic Los Ingobernables De Japon leader has the world at his feet at the moment. It's widely thought that he'll defeat Okada at Wrestle Kingdom 12 on 4 January and embark on a long, successful run as IWGP Heavyweight Champion, delivering a year comparable to 'The Rainmaker's' incredible 2017. If so, he'll be doing it on the back of his own banner year

Naito started the year as IWGP Intercontinental Champion, defending the belt against opponents as diverse as company legend Hiroshi Tanahashi, powerhouse Michael Elgin, and the up-and-coming Juice Robinson. Tana would take his belt eventually, but Naito's excellence continued. He engaged in multiple wars of attrition with Tomohiro Ishii, a heart-in-mouth masterpiece with Kota Ibushi, and produced a flawless performance against Kenny Omega in the G1 Climax tournament finals, securing his Wrestle Kingdom headlining spot.

The undisputed coolest wrestler on the planet, Tetsuya Naito's work is carried by his carefree charisma, with the 'Ingobernables' gimmick as fresh today as it was at its inception. Okada's had a great run, but we can't wait for his rival to take the to spot.
